The u.s. department of energy reported a major scientific breakthrough in nuclear fusion science in december 2022. for the first time, more energy was released from a fusion reaction than was used to ignite it. while this achievement is indeed historic, it’s important to pause and reflect on the way ahead for fusion energy.
